記事内にはプロモーションが含まれています

HTMLの難易度は低い!プログラミング初心者でも挫折しない理由

HTMLの難易度は低い!プログラミング初心者でも挫折しない理由 プログラミング言語
「Webサイトを作ってみたいけれど、HTMLって難しそう……」
「プログラミング未経験の私でも習得できるのかな?」

これからWeb制作やエンジニアを目指そうとしている方にとって、最初の入り口となる「HTML」の難易度は非常に気になるところでしょう。

結論からお伝えすると、HTMLの習得難易度は、ITスキルの中で最も低い(易しい)部類に入ります。

JavaやPythonといった一般的な「プログラミング言語」と比較すると、覚えるべきルールは非常にシンプルで、挫折する人は極めて少ない言語です。

しかし、HTML単体ではWebサイトが完成しないため、「Web制作全体」として見ると難易度の感じ方は変わってきます。

この記事では、HTMLの難易度が低いと言われる具体的な理由から、セットで学ぶことになるCSSの壁、そして習得にかかる時間の目安まで、現在のWeb制作事情を踏まえて徹底解説します。

【著者プロフィール&本記事の信頼性】
プロフィール
  • 著者は元エンジニア
  • 大手プログラミングスクールのWebディレクター兼 ライターを経験
  • 自らも地元密着型のプログラミングスクールを運営
プロフィール詳細はコチラ

【忙しい方向け:エンジニア転職の「正解」を先出し】

数あるスクールを徹底比較した結果、未経験から本気でプロを目指すなら、今の選択肢は「RUNTEQ」一択です。

  • 給付金で実質13万円〜の圧倒的なコスパ
  • ✅ 現場で通用する「本物の開発力」が身につく
  • ✅ 受講生コミュニティの活発さが業界No.1

※無理な勧誘は一切ありません。相談だけでも価値があります。


HTMLの習得難易度は「レベル1」!最も易しいと言われる理由

HTMLの習得難易度は「レベル1」!最も易しいと言われる理由

ITエンジニアやWebデザイナーを目指す上で、HTMLは「最初に学ぶべき言語」として定着しています。
なぜなら、他の言語と比べて圧倒的に仕組みが単純で、誰でもすぐに結果を目にすることができるからです。

ここでは、なぜHTMLが「簡単」だと言われるのか、その理由を3つ解説します。

そもそも「プログラミング言語」ではない

厳密に言うと、HTML(HyperText Markup Language)はプログラミング言語ではなく、「マークアップ言語」 です。

プログラミング言語(PythonやC言語など)では、計算処理や条件分岐、繰り返し処理といった「論理的な思考(アルゴリズム)」が求められます。
「もしAならBをする、そうでなければCをする」といったロジックを組み立てる必要があり、ここで多くの初心者がつまずきます。

一方、HTMLの役割は「文章に印(マーク)をつけて意味を持たせること」だけです。

「ここは見出しです」「ここは段落です」「ここは画像です」と、タグを使ってコンピューターに伝えるだけなので、複雑な計算やロジックは一切必要ありません。

「囲むだけ」のシンプルな文法

HTMLの基本ルールは、対象の文字をタグと呼ばれる記号 < > で囲むだけです。

実際にコードを見てみましょう。

<h1>これは一番大きな見出しです</h1>
<p>これは文章の段落です。</p>
<a href="
Google
(https://google.com)">これはリンクです</a>

コードの解説

  • <h1></h1>:この間にある文字が「見出し」になります。
  • <p></p>:この間にある文字が「段落」になります。
  • <a>:リンクを作成します。

このように、基本的には「開始タグ」と「終了タグ」で文字を挟むだけで記述が完了します。

英単語の意味(Header、Paragraph、Anchor)さえなんとなくわかれば、直感的に理解できる構造になっています。

環境構築が不要ですぐに始められる

多くのプログラミング言語は、学習を始める前に「環境構築」という高いハードルがあります。

専用のソフトをインストールしたり、パソコンの設定を変更したりする必要があり、コードを書く前に挫折してしまう人も少なくありません。

しかし、HTMLは「メモ帳(テキストエディタ)」と「Webブラウザ(ChromeやEdge)」さえあれば動きます。

特別な準備なしに、今使っているパソコンですぐに学習をスタートできる点も、難易度が低い大きな理由です。

【注意】HTMLは簡単だが「CSS」とセットになると難易度が上がる

【注意】HTMLは簡単だが「CSS」とセットになると難易度が上がる

「HTMLは簡単」というのは事実ですが、実務レベルのWebサイトを作ろうとすると話は別です。

HTMLはあくまで「骨組み」を作るものであり、見た目を整えるには 「CSS」 という別の言語が必須になるからです。

HTMLだけで書かれたWebページは、大学の論文のような「白い背景に黒い文字が並んでいるだけ」の状態です。
色を付けたり、レイアウトを横並びにしたり、スマホで見やすく調整したりするにはCSSが必要です。

このCSSが登場した途端、学習の難易度はレベル1からレベル5くらいまで一気に跳ね上がります。

「要素が思った場所に配置できない(レイアウト崩れ)」
「スマホで見ると文字がはみ出す(レスポンシブ対応)」
「クラス名の付け方がわからない」

多くの初心者が挫折を感じるのは、HTMLそのものではなく、このCSSによるレイアウト調整の部分です。

「HTMLは簡単だけど、思い通りのデザインにするのは難しい」と認識しておくと、学習のギャップに苦しまずに済みます。

初心者がHTML/CSSを習得するまでの勉強時間目安

初心者がHTML/CSSを習得するまでの勉強時間目安

HTMLとCSSを学び始めてから、実際にWebサイトを作れるようになるまで、どのくらいの時間がかかるのでしょうか。

個人の学習ペースにもよりますが、一般的な目安を紹介します。

基礎理解(HTML):約1週間〜2週間

HTMLのタグの使い方や、基本的な構造を理解するだけであれば、1週間から2週間程度で十分です。

h1pimgultable といった頻出タグを覚え、簡単な自己紹介ページを作れるレベルを目指します。

この段階では、暗記しようとせず「こんなタグがあるんだな」と理解する程度で構いません。

Webサイト模写レベル(HTML + CSS):約1ヶ月〜3ヶ月

既存のWebサイトのデザインを真似してコーディングする「模写」ができるようになるには、1ヶ月〜3ヶ月程度の学習が必要です。

ここではFlexboxやGridといったCSSのレイアウト技術や、スマホ対応(レスポンシブデザイン)の知識が求められます。

ここまで到達できれば、副業や就職活動のためのポートフォリオ作成に着手できるレベルと言えます。

HTML関連の資格と難易度

HTML関連の資格と難易度

Web制作のスキルを証明するために、資格の取得を検討する方もいるでしょう。

HTMLに関連する代表的な資格とその難易度について簡単に解説します。

HTML5プロフェッショナル認定試験

LPI-Japanが主催する、HTML/CSS/JavaScriptなどのWeb制作スキルを認定する試験です。

レベル1(難易度:普通)
HTMLとCSSの基礎から応用、レスポンシブデザインなど、Web制作の静的な部分を問われます。
実務未経験者でも、2〜3ヶ月しっかり勉強すれば合格可能です。
レベル2(難易度:高い)
JavaScriptによる動的な処理やシステム連携など、より高度なフロントエンド開発スキルが問われます。
こちらはプログラミングの知識が必要になるため、難易度は高くなります。

Webクリエイター能力認定試験

サーティファイが主催する民間資格で、実際の制作現場に近い形でのコーディング能力を問われます。

スタンダード(難易度:易しい)
実技試験のみで、HTML/CSSの修正や基本的なページ作成を行います。
初心者でも合格しやすく、自信をつけるのにおすすめです。
エキスパート(難易度:普通)
知識問題と実技試験があり、より実践的なレイアウト技術が求められます。

なお、これらの資格を取得することは必須ではありません。

Web業界は実力主義であり、資格を持っていることよりも「実際にどんなサイトが作れるか(ポートフォリオ)」が重視されます。

資格勉強は体系的に知識を整理するのに役立ちますが、就職や転職において必須条件ではないことは覚えておきましょう。

まとめ

今回は、HTMLの難易度について解説しました。

  • HTML自体の難易度は低い:プログラミング的なロジックが不要で、タグで囲むだけのシンプルな構造。
  • CSSとセットで考えると奥が深い:レイアウトやデザインの調整には学習が必要。
  • 学習期間:基礎なら数週間、サイト制作レベルなら数ヶ月が目安。

「難しそう」と身構える必要はありません。
HTMLは書けば書くほど画面に結果が表示される、とても楽しい言語です。

まずはメモ帳を開いて、自分の名前を <h1> タグで囲んで保存し、ブラウザで開いてみてください。
その小さな一歩が、Webクリエイターへの第一歩になります。


【忙しい方向け:エンジニア転職の「正解」を先出し】

数あるスクールを徹底比較した結果、未経験から本気でプロを目指すなら、今の選択肢は「RUNTEQ」一択です。

  • 給付金で実質13万円〜の圧倒的なコスパ
  • ✅ 現場で通用する「本物の開発力」が身につく
  • ✅ 受講生コミュニティの活発さが業界No.1

※無理な勧誘は一切ありません。相談だけでも価値があります。


おすすめエージェント
当ブログ著者
当ブログ著者
\ 登録・利用はすべて完全無料! /
未経験からのエンジニア転職を成功させたい
ユニゾンキャリア
実務未経験エンジニアでも希望の転職先を見つけやすい!!

スキルを活かして副業で稼ぎたい
MidWorks(ミッドワークス)
週1~3日からできる副業案件多数!!

フリーランスとして高単価な案件を獲得したい
レバテックフリーランス
フリーランス案件の単価の高さは圧倒的!!